Lifewide learning courses and programmes

Performance analysis

This course teaches performance analysis of modern computer and communication systems. Course contents include stochastics, single-server queues, multi-server queueing systems, queueing networks and resource sharing.

Schedule:

Teaching time:

Daytime Evening

Topic:

Mathematics

Form of learning:

Exam On-campus

Provider:

Aalto University, FITech

Level:

Advanced

Credits:

5 By Aalto University (ECTS)

Fee:

Free of charge

Application period:

7.11.2023 – 9.4.2024

Target group and prerequisites

Basic knowledge of modelling and analysis of communication networks.

Course description

This course teaches performance analysis of modern computer and communication systems.

Course contents

  1. Recap of prerequisities
  2. Stochastics: Conditional expectation. Phase-type distributions. Reversibility. Regenerative processes.
  3. Single-server queues: M/G/1-FIFO queue. M/G/1-PS queue. Optimal scheduling problem. Applications.
  4. Multi-server queueing systems: Separability. Optimal dispatching problem. Applications.
  5. Queueing networks: Open queueing networks. Closed queueing networks. Applications.
  6. Resource sharing: Max-min fairness, Alpha-fairness, Balanced fairness. Applications.

Learning outcomes

After the course, the student

  • is able to apply Markov processes and regenerative processes to model various computer and communication systems;
  • is able to construct, analyse and optimise stochastic queueing models to evaluate the performance of the system;
  • comprehends selected applications of the performance analysis of modern computer and communication systems.

Course material

Lecture slides (online)

Teaching schedule

  • Lectures on Tuesdays and Thursdays at 9–12
  • Exercises on Mondays and Wednesdays at 16–18
  • Exam on 5.6.2024 at 16.30–19.30

Completion methods

Examination (100%), exercises.

  • Updated:
Share
URL copied!